Regional Analysis
Madrid region dominates the Spain data center networking market, accounting for approximately 42% of total market activity. The capital region benefits from its concentration of multinational corporations, government agencies, and technology companies that drive significant demand for advanced networking solutions. Madrid’s position as a major business hub and its excellent connectivity infrastructure make it the primary market for data center networking investments.
Catalonia region, centered around Barcelona, represents the second-largest market segment with 28% market share. The region’s strong industrial base, growing technology sector, and strategic location as a gateway to Europe contribute to robust demand for data center networking solutions. Barcelona’s emergence as a major technology hub and its hosting of significant international events drive infrastructure investments.
Andalusia region is experiencing rapid growth in data center networking adoption, driven by increasing digitalization initiatives and the expansion of technology services. The region’s strategic location and growing business services sector are contributing to increased demand for modern networking infrastructure. Government digitalization programs are particularly active in this region.
Valencia region shows strong growth potential with expanding manufacturing and logistics sectors driving demand for industrial IoT and edge computing solutions. The region’s port facilities and transportation infrastructure create unique networking requirements that drive specialized solution adoption.
Basque Country demonstrates high adoption rates of advanced networking technologies, supported by the region’s strong industrial base and emphasis on innovation. The concentration of manufacturing companies and research institutions drives demand for high-performance networking solutions that can support Industry 4.0 initiatives.

Category-wise Insights
Switching Solutions Category dominates the Spain data center networking market, representing the foundational infrastructure required for modern data center operations. This category includes top-of-rack switches, spine-leaf architectures, and modular switching platforms that provide high-bandwidth connectivity and low-latency performance. The segment is experiencing strong growth driven by increasing data volumes and the adoption of virtualization technologies.
Software-Defined Networking Category is experiencing the highest growth rate with 52% year-over-year adoption increase as organizations seek greater network agility and automation capabilities. SDN solutions enable centralized network management, policy enforcement, and dynamic resource allocation, making them particularly attractive for organizations with complex networking requirements.
Network Security Category is gaining prominence as organizations prioritize cybersecurity and regulatory compliance. Integrated security solutions that combine networking and security functions are becoming increasingly popular, offering simplified management and improved threat protection capabilities. The category benefits from growing awareness of cybersecurity risks and regulatory requirements.
Routing Equipment Category focuses on high-performance routing solutions that enable efficient traffic management and inter-network connectivity. This category is particularly important for service providers and large enterprises with complex network architectures requiring advanced routing capabilities and traffic optimization features.
Network Management Category encompasses solutions for monitoring, managing, and optimizing data center network performance. AI-driven network management tools are gaining traction, offering predictive analytics, automated troubleshooting, and proactive performance optimization capabilities that reduce operational complexity and improve network reliability.
